Growing strong muscle for better performance and weight loss  

Alexander Bartelt,
Leonardo Matta

Abstract: Growing strong muscle for better performance and weight loss   Physical activity and exercise have beneficial effects on overall fitness and health. However, exercise-induced increases in metabolism require specific molecular adaptation of the muscle cells. This project aims to understand the molecular processes in the muscle during the adaptation to cold, exercise and obesity, thereby defining novel mechanisms of protein homeostasis with regard to the gene switch Nfe2l1.
